anir22 Posted October 29, 2013 Report Share Posted October 29, 2013 Just did it on my X930BT without a single hiccup Downloaded the update via torrent and unzipped it's contents into a folder. Downloaded the updated VERINFO.DAT file and put it in the \Update directory of the unzipped files, replacing the previous file in the folder. Then placed the 3 files on the SD car; FIRMWARE folder, Update folder, and CARDINFO.cif Powered the unit up, popped in the SD card, and within about 5 seconds it picked it up and asked to start the update. That update process took about 20 minutes Once that's done the unit reboots and finishes updating After that, you're greeted with language setup options Once that's done, the update is complete! By the way, if you're using a custom start up splash screen (as I am), you will not see any 2012 Pioneer splash screen for confirmation, because you're custom one is still going to show, so don't freak out when that doesn't show up upon the unit rebooting, lol. After you go through the language setup, it's going to ask to do the update again. If you don't want to sit there for another 20 minutes, hit no... To update the bluetooth firmware, go into your settings menu Go into the bluetooth settings menu, and scroll to the bottom where you'll find the firmware update option Press it and it'll show you your current firmware and under that will be the option to update it Once that's pressed, you're prompted with one more confirmation of the update showing you version info of what you're currently running and what's going to be installed Hit yes and wait for it to update; takes about 3 or 4 minutes to complete Once that's done, you'll have the new app connection option for bluetooth or wired connection Pair to your Android phone (which you will have to do over again since you updated the bluetooth firmware which erased any stored phones) and you'll get a new list of options in you sources!
